我刚刚投入到一个SAP项目中,我需要使用SAPsBAPI从客户端SAP系统中提取大量信息。鉴于SAP是一个封闭的平台,我一直难以找到什么是BAPI的高级概述。我知道你可能会花一辈子的时间使用这些ERP系统,但仍然不了解整个事情,所以我只想要一个基本的概述,这样我就可以与“客户的”SAP人员进行明智的交谈。具体来说我的问题是:BAPI只是SOAP和/或XML-RPC的包装器,还是一种完全专有的通信格式?如何从外部PHP使用这些API?我看到了与这些BAPI相关的首字母缩略词ABAP,是否有些相关? 最佳答案 BAPI(“业务API”)
设置:树莓派nginx网络服务器已安装PHP5和PHP-CLI我的Python脚本“lights.py”真的很酷,因为它通过连接到ArduinoUno的继电器打开/关闭我客厅的灯[然后通过USB连接到Pi]。我知道我可以使用Pi的GPIO引脚,但我没有。无论如何,这在这里并不重要。我希望能够通过我的Pi托管的站点从Web浏览器激活脚本,所以我有包含以下代码的/var/wwww/test/lights.php:很简单,不是吗?好吧,当我在浏览器中浏览到该页面时,没有任何显示(预期),但灯没有改变状态(意外)。但是,在命令行中,以用户Pi身份登录,我可以运行“php/var/wwww/te
项目系统是SAP执行项目和组合管理的关键模块之一。它可以帮助您从结构化到规划,执行到项目完成,来管理项目生命周期。项目系统与其他SAP模块紧密结合,如物流,物料管理,销售和分销,工厂维护和生产计划模块。 它使组织能够有效地管理所有SAP项目-大型和小型项目。项目经理的任务是确保这些项目在预算和时间内执行,并确保资源按照要求分配给项目。在项目启动之前,要求项目目标明确,活动结构化。SAP项目系统PS与SAPERPR/3应用程序模块之间的集成允许您作为正常项目过程的一部分来设计,计划和执行项目。因此,项目系统模块具有对项目所涉及的所有部门的不间断数据访问。项目分类根据预算,项目可以分为以下类别-外
我在2个不同的日子里遇到了这个错误,并且浪费了大部分时间来寻找解决方案。充其量,我找到了临时解决方法而不是永久解决方案。实际问题甚至可能是AndroidStudio中的错误。我的问题:我有一个AndroidStudio项目在我将AS更新到2.3.0后停止正确构建。该项目在其布局文件、AndroidGradle插件2.3.0、Gradle2.4.1中使用了Google数据绑定(bind)。收到的错误是在dataBindingProcessLayoutsDebug任务中提示无关的输入字符,'\r'这是旧式mac行结尾。在另一个文本编辑器中查看我的布局文件后,我注意到我的一些布局文件包含错误
我正在从事一个使用移动应用程序控制机器人的项目。到目前为止,我已经设法发送蓝牙命令让机器人按需移动。但是我无法接收来自超声波传感器HC-SR04的输入,它每秒给出一个浮点值。我已经编写了将float转换为字节的代码,然后将字节写入串行并使用java应用程序在textview上读取和显示它们。但是我在textview上只得到一个问号,我假设它表明我能够在channel上接收数据,字节不完整或者我的转换是错误的?请帮忙。##########这是我发送字节的python脚本whileTrue:a=ser.read()#readfromtheserialportser.close()dist=
我正在使用以下代码为RaspberryPi3语音转文本Intentintent=newIntent(RecognizerIntent.ACTION_RECOGNIZE_SPEECH);intent.putExtra(RecognizerIntent.EXTRA_LANGUAGE_MODEL,RecognizerIntent.LANGUAGE_MODEL_FREE_FORM);intent.putExtra(RecognizerIntent.EXTRA_LANGUAGE,"en-US");try{startActivityForResult(intent,RESULT_SPEECH);}
我在RaspberryPI2B+中使用此配置进行wifi直接连接ctrl_interface=DIR=/var/run/wpa_supplicantdriver_param=use_p2p_group_interface=1update_config=1device_name=Raspberry_pidevice_type=1-0050F204-1p2p_go_intent=1p2p_go_ht40=1country=IN然后使用启动wpasupplicantsudowpa_supplicant-Dnl80211-iwlan0-c/etc/wpa_supplicant/p2p.conf
如何使用adb连接到运行AndroidThings的RaspberryPi3? 最佳答案 AndroidThingsforRaspberryPi仅支持通过以下命令使用adb-over-ip连接到adb:adbconnect``根据您的Pi设置,您有多个选项来查找您的IP地址:如果您的Pi已连接到以太网和屏幕:它应该会在AndroidThings启动器屏幕上向您显示其IP地址。如果你有一个连接到以太网的headlessPi:你可以直接pingAndroid.local如果你有mDNS/Bonjour支持,或者查看https://lea
此代码用于从其字符串表示形式生成XML文档。它在我的小型单元测试中运行良好,但在我的实际xml数据中却失败了。它触发的行是Documentdoc=db.parse(is);有什么想法吗?publicstaticDocumentFromString(Stringxml){//fromhttp://www.rgagnon.com/javadetails/java-0573.htmltry{DocumentBuilderFactorydbf=DocumentBuilderFactory.newInstance();DocumentBuilderdb=dbf.newDocumentBuilde
如何在AndroidThingsforRaspberryPi3上使用UART外设?它似乎默认分配了linux控制台。 最佳答案 默认情况下,UART端口映射到linux控制台,以防止内核消息干扰您的外围设备。您可以通过使用以下方法从主机上的SD卡安装引导分区来禁用控制台:mount/dev/sdX1/mnt/disk其中sdX替换为您的sdcard读卡器设备名称(将sdcard插入读卡器后运行dmesg应该可以帮助您找出设备名称)。然后编辑/mnt/disk/cmdline.txt以替换以下内核引导参数:console=serial